The Research Ethics Office is dedicated to ensuring that all research, in particular involving human participants, is conducted ethically and to the highest standard of Integrity. To this end the College Research Ethics Committee (CREC) has assumed responsibility for the review of all College sponsored, non-clinical research, via Research Ethics Subcommittees (High Risk Research), Research Ethics Panels and Single Reviewer Reviews (Low Risk Research).

REMAS is the fully integrated online application system through which applications for ethical review should be made for all risk levels of research. The system is managed by the Research Ethics Office who can be contacted with any queries at rec@kcl.ac.uk. Full contact details are provided in the contacts section.
